What companies run services between Bonn, Germany and Newcastle upon Tyne, England?

You can take a train from Bonn Hbf to Newcastle via Koeln Hbf, Brussel-Zuid / Bruxelles-Midi, London St Pancras Intl, and King's Cross in around 8h 59m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Bonn UN Campus to John Dobson Street via London Victoria in around 21h 14m.
